Clear All Filters
GANT Black Cord Collar Worker Overshirt
£175
FatFace Khaki Green Washed Canvas Garment Dye Chore Jacket
£75
MOSS Blue Waffle Texture Overshirt
£90
River Island Black Slim Fit Formal Shirt
£22
MOSS Blue Tailored Stretch Shirt
£38
Brook Taverner Dark Blue Single Cuff Shirt
£60
AllSaints Grey Castleford Jacket
£169
Dark Green Slim Fit Long Sleeve Oxford Shirt
£26
Barbour® Navy Bayview Overshirt
£119
Superdry Black Essential Long Sleeve Denim Shirt
£45